About Tim Draper's portfolio

How many companies has Tim Draper invested in?

Tim Draper has invested in 50 companies tracked in our database. The portfolio spans multiple industries and funding stages, from seed-stage startups to late-stage companies.

What industries does Tim Draper invest in?

Tim Draper's top investment sectors include Information Technology, FinTech, Software, Bitcoin, Financial Services. The firm invests across 68 different industry categories.

What is Tim Draper's largest investment?

Among tracked funding rounds, Datawallet received $40.0M in a Initial Coin Offering round. Tim Draper's total known invested capital is $191.1M.

What is the average investment size for Tim Draper?

Tim Draper's average investment size is $5.3M across its portfolio of 50 companies.
